Requirements: Completed the LCCI Elementary Book-Keeping
The aims of the examination are to test the candidates':
· understanding of the basic principles
underlying the recording of business
transactions
· ability to prepare and interpret
accounts for sole traders, partnerships,
non-trading
organisations and limited companies
Course Outline
1. Advanced aspects of the syllabus for
Book-keeping First Level
2. Partnerships
3. Limited liability companies
4. Incomplete records
5. Manufacturing accounts
6. Stock valuation
7. Non-trading organisations
8. Branch accounts (excluding foreign
branches)
9. Bills of Exchange receivable and
payable
10. Consignment accounts
11. Control accounts
12. Suspense accounts
13. Calculation and interpretation of
ratios
14. The preparation of final accounts
15. Treatment of Provision and Reserves
